To understand the current landscape, we must look at the video game industry. For decades, PC gamers dealt with "patches" via dial-up bulletin boards, but the console market remained static. Borrowing a term from software development, patched entertainment refers to media that is altered, updated, corrected, or expanded after its initial public release. Similar to software updates, movies, streaming series, and digital media are now frequently modified, corrected, or enhanced after their public release. This trend, accelerated by streaming services and high-speed internet, allows creators to fix on-screen errors, update visual effects, or even alter scenes based on audience reception.
